# Break-Glass: Catalog Cache Invalidation

Scope: the Pinrow product catalog at Veldstone Retail. If stale prices persist after a purge and the Hollowmere invalidation queue is wedged, use break-glass to flush the edge tier directly. Contractors: get verbal sign-off from the catalog lead first. Steps: open the Hollowmere admin shell, select emergency-flush, confirm the tenant, and run it once — repeated flushes thrash the origin. Access is logged and expires after 20 minutes. Unseal the admin shell with the passphrase below.

recovery phrase for kahop-tajog: istix-casvan

Cartwheel's dispatch engine assigns drivers using a weighted score: proximity (50%), recent idle time (30%), and vehicle fit (20%). Support should know that ties break alphabetically by driver handle, which occasionally produces odd-looking assignments in the Bellport region. This is expected behavior, not a defect. If a customer disputes an assignment, log the job number and the heuristic version shown in the dispatch panel. Questions about the scoring weights themselves should go to our vendor liaison at the address below.

escalation mailbox, fafof-bahip: tamael@ordincorp.test

Handover: AddrSnap widget. Debounce is 180ms, don't lower it — the Quillden geocoder rate-limits hard. Suggestions cache lives in-memory only; cold start is fine. Known bug: diacritics in street names break highlighting (ticket filed). Deploys go through the Marlowe pipeline, staging first, always. The service account for the geocoder proxy locked me out twice; if it happens, use the recovery flow. The recovery passphrase for that account is below.

strongbox words: zormir-quenath-sorax

Q4 Planning Note — Sales Leads, Tarnwell Instruments

Hi all — quick one on the budget ask. We're requesting an additional 12% for the field team next quarter, mostly to cover two new regional hires in Arden Bay and expanded demo kits for the Vireo analyzer. Finance is receptive but wants our pipeline numbers firmed up by the 15th, so please get your forecasts to Jonas early. The rationale ties into the roadmap outlined below.

board note of fafog-yahap: Project Rusdor slips by a full year because of the audit delay.